3.1
Intended use
The intended area of use for the BioPhotometer plus is the research laboratory in molecular
biology, biochemistry and cell biology. The device may only be operated by trained specialist
staff.
The BioPhotometer plus is used to perform photometric measurements to quantify biomolecules
as well as to perform turbidity measurements of microbiological cultures in routine laboratories.
Due to the specific examination of selected parameters, the device serves to monitor laboratory
processes. Use only Eppendorf accessories or accessories recommended by Eppendorf AG.
3.2
Warnings for intended use
DANGER!
Danger! Electric shock from damage to device/power cable.
Only switch on the device if the device and the power cable are undamaged.
Only use devices that have been properly installed or repaired.
DANGER!
Danger! Electric shock as a result of penetration of liquid.
Switch off the device and disconnect it from the power supply before starting cleaning or
disinfecting.
Do not allow any liquids to penetrate the inside of the housing.
Do not disinfect by means of spraying.
Only reconnect the device to the power supply once it is completely dry.
DANGER!
Danger! Electric shock.
Switch off the device and disconnect the power plug before opening the device to replace the
fuses. These tasks may only be performed by appropriately trained staff.
DANGER!
Risk of explosion!
Do not operate the device in rooms where work is being carried out with explosive
substances.
Do not use this device to process any explosive, radioactive or highly reactive substances.
Do not use this device to process any substances, which could create an explosive
atmosphere.
DANGER!
Risk when handling toxic or radioactively-marked liquids or pathogenic germs.
Follow national regulations governing the handling of these substances.
For complete instructions regarding the handling of germs or biological material of risk group
II or higher, please refer to the "Laboratory Biosafety Manual" (Source: World Health
Organization, current edition of the Laboratory Biosafety Manual).
WARNING!
Warning! Damage to health from chemicals.
Hazardous chemicals cause burns and other health hazards.
Follow the instructions for use provided by the manufacturers of reagents and other
chemicals.
WARNING!
Warning! Poor safety due to incorrect accessories.
The use of accessories and spare parts other than those recommended by Eppendorf may
impair the safety, function and precision of the device. Eppendorf accepts no warranty or liability
for damage caused by third-party parts or incorrect use.
Use only original accessories recommended by Eppendorf.
